(我正在使用json和PHP)
嗨我有一个网址,来自一些网络服务说:
http://www.example.com?username= $用户名和安培;密码= $密码&安培; FNAME =名字
现在他们说他们可以用xml或json获取数据来检索数据并传递我的用户名和密码。当我用Google搜索时发现json是更好的选择。现在我已经完成了json并成功收到了所需的数据。
但我可以看到我曾经在视图源中获取的所有javascript。密码用户名也是如此。
在使用json或者说使用REST获取数据时,我是一名新程序员。
任何人都可以让我知道基本想法,这对我来说已经足够了。
答案 0 :(得分:2)
您需要做的是使用PHP获取该URL。为此,最常用的是cURL:
$parameters = array(
'username'=>$username,
'password'=>$password,
'fname'=>$fname
);
$ch = curl_init('http://www.example.com?' . http_build_query($parameters);
curl_setopt($ch, CURLOPT_HEADER, 0);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
$output = curl_exec($ch);
curl_close($ch);
echo $output;
您应该使用您的代码查看该网址中的数据。现在,因为它是JSON,我们需要解码:
print_r(json_decode($output));
您应该看到一个PHP对象,您可以根据需要访问其属性。